宝哥软件园

怎样在excel复选框全选功能

编辑:宝哥软件园 来源:互联网 时间:2025-03-01

在Excel中,复选框(Checkbox)常用于数据筛选、状态标记或交互式报表设计。对于需要批量操作的场景,实现“全选”功能可以显著提升效率。本文将详细介绍如何在中国地区常用的Excel版本(如Office 2016/2019或WPS表格)中实现复选框的全选功能,并提供实际应用案例和注意事项。

怎样在excel复选框全选功能图1

一、复选框的基础操作与全选功能需求
在中国用户的日常工作中,Excel常用于处理考勤统计、问卷调查或产品清单等场景。例如,某公司需要从数百条产品记录中筛选出符合条件的数据,若逐个勾选复选框效率极低。此时,通过一个“全选”复选框控制其他复选框的状态,能够快速完成批量操作。

二、实现全选功能的两种方法
1. 使用表单控件复选框+公式联动
步骤一:通过「开发工具」-「插入」选择「表单控件」中的复选框,创建“全选”控件。
步骤二:为每个需要关联的复选框设置链接单元格(右键复选框-「设置控件格式」-「单元格链接」)。
步骤三:在“全选”复选框的链接单元格(如A1)输入公式:
=IF(A1=TRUE, 全选, 取消)
步骤四:通过条件格式或VBA代码将所有子复选框状态与A1单元格绑定,实现一键控制。

2. 使用ActiveX控件+VBA编程
对于需要更复杂逻辑的场景,可通过VBA代码实现:
Private Sub CheckBox1_Click()
    Dim cb As MSForms.CheckBox
    For Each cb In Sheet1.OLEObjects
        If cb.Name <> CheckBox1 Then cb.Object.Value = CheckBox1.Value
    Next
End Sub

此代码会遍历所有复选框,并将主控复选框状态同步到子项。

怎样在excel复选框全选功能图2

三、中国用户特别注意事项
1. 版本兼容性问题:WPS表格对ActiveX控件支持有限,建议优先使用表单控件方案
2. 批量操作优化:处理超过100个复选框时,建议使用定义名称+INDIRECT函数动态引用,避免卡顿
3. 界面适配技巧:按住Alt键拖动复选框可实现像素级对齐,符合国内用户对表格美观的要求

四、典型应用场景示例
1. 销售数据筛选:某电商运营团队使用全选功能快速导出华东地区所有订单
2. 人事考勤管理:HR通过复选框全选标记全勤人员,效率提升70%
3. 市场调研分析:一键选择所有有效问卷数据,自动生成可视化图表

五、常见问题解决方案
复选框显示不全:右键设置「大小与属性」-取消「锁定纵横比」
打印时丢失控件:在「页面布局」-「工作表选项」勾选「打印对象」
移动端兼容问题:建议将复选框状态转换为TRUE/FALSE文本,便于微信传输查看

六、总结
掌握Excel复选框全选功能,不仅能提升数据处理效率,更符合中国用户对表格智能化的需求。通过本文介绍的两种实现方式,用户可根据具体场景选择合适方案。建议搭配数据验证、条件格式等功能,构建完整的交互式报表系统,充分释放Excel在办公自动化中的潜力。

更多资讯
游戏推荐
更多+